
Financial statutory and consolidation specialist
Job Description
Introduction to the job
As financial statutory and consolidation specialist, you work at the center of global financial consolidation and reporting. You ensure accuracy, compliance, and continuous improvement while collaborating with internal and external stakeholders worldwide.
Role and responsibilities
As financial statutory and consolidation specialist, you will play a key role in worldwide ASML group consolidation. You will drive on time and accurate internal and external reporting on financials (US GAAP and IFRS), including XBRL filings. Furthermore, you will engage in different projects and take part in continuous improvement activities (process/cooperation/system) to ensure we remain a world-class finance organization, keeping up with the growth of ASML. You will collaborate with various stakeholders such as Finance Operations teams, Business Insights & Control, Expert Accounting teams, Legal, and work closely with external auditors.
In this role, you will:
- Perform analytical review on consolidated level to ensure correctness of the consolidated numbers
- Support the quality and support on the reporting of financial and non-financial information
- Ensure SOx compliance for the consolidation processes
- Contribute to the statutory reporting process for the legal entities;
- Prepare account reconciliations and explanations and correction on any variances
- Ensure elimination of intercompany transactions and balances
- Assist in preparation of quarter and annual financial statements (IFRS and US GAAP) and timely report on month end, quarter end and annual functions and figures
Education and experience
Master’s degree in business economics or accounting
Minimum of 5 years relevant working experience
Experience with consolidation, US GAAP and IFRS
Understanding of financial accounting processes, inclusive of the automation tooling supportive to the consolidation and external reporting process
Experience with Excel, and preferably with SAP and BPC
Fluent English speaking and writing
